Overview

Superoxide dismutase 3 (SOD3) mRNA is an mRNA-based therapeutic designed to induce the expression of the extracellular superoxide dismutase enzyme. SOD3 is a key antioxidant enzyme that localizes to the extracellular matrix, where it catalyzes the dismutation of superoxide radicals into hydrogen peroxide and oxygen. By delivering the genetic instructions for SOD3 via mRNA, typically encapsulated in lipid nanoparticles (LNPs), the therapy aims to restore antioxidant capacity in tissues under high oxidative stress. This approach is primarily being investigated for cardiovascular and pulmonary conditions, such as heart failure, ischemic heart disease, and inflammatory lung diseases like acute lung injury or idiopathic pulmonary fibrosis. The goal is to mitigate the tissue damage, fibrosis, and inflammation driven by excessive reactive oxygen species (ROS).
